About this book
This volume details the most up-to-date technologies used in plant transposable element studies and provides easy-to-follow protocols. Chapters guide readers on available database resources, annotation of different families of transposon, and experimental methods to detect their transposition intermediates, neo-transposed DNAs, and transposition events.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ls.
Authoritative and cutting-edge, Plant Transposable Elements: Methods and Protocols aims to provide web-lab and dry-lab methodologies targeted at various levels from beginner to experienced.
